## Who to ping about GiftNote

Welcome aboard! GiftNote is our donation-receipt mailer for the Larchfield Fund. Template tweaks go to the comms folks; delivery failures and bounce weirdness go to the platform crew. Don't push template changes on Fridays — receipts batch over the weekend. For anything GiftNote-related, start with the address below.

billing contact of kaweg-tajeg = drudor.lamion.oliath@torvalabs.test

TICKET-4410: LintHarbor baseline sync failing

The static-analysis baseline file for the Quillfork repo won't refresh — the baseline service drops the connection mid-upload. You're new, so note: the baseline store lives in the Tarnwick cluster, not the CI box. Retry with keepalives enabled first. Connect directly using the string below.

replica DSN, kajep-yahag: mssql://praok_svc:iF@db-8d68.plorvaio.local:5432/eliion

Subject: TaxGrid lookup cache — release 14.2 notes

Team, the tax-rate lookup cache in TaxGrid now refreshes jurisdiction tables every 20 minutes instead of hourly, reducing stale-rate windows during mid-quarter updates. We also added negative-result caching with a 60-second TTL to absorb lookup storms. Please verify cache-hit dashboards after deploy and flag anomalies in the release channel. For verification, the build trace token is included directly below.

pipeline stamp: htk9_ce63042d9

Hi — quick handover before I head off. The evacuation-chair store on Level 3 at Quenmore Point got a new lock fitted after last week's audit, so the old key in the reception drawer is useless now. Contractors servicing the chairs on Thursday will need to get in themselves since I'll be off-site. Please make sure they sign the equipment log inside and close the door firmly — it doesn't self-latch. They can open the store with the pass code below.

door code, tahop-fahap: bdg-JZCXMY-37375484